Output 8114de6f479a5f53d0388fa8076b8321cf6f8de57c381716bbe87b1f4ec406d5:19

value
118700
script pubkey
OP_0 OP_PUSHBYTES_20 34f81e51d0fca2757e68285c37e9d61bfadcb1c3
address
bc1qxnupu5wslj382lng9pwr06wkr0adevwrtg535t
transaction
8114de6f479a5f53d0388fa8076b8321cf6f8de57c381716bbe87b1f4ec406d5
confirmations
239445
spent
true